Luckily we didn't have the a minister for Transport like Earnst Marple in the UK, that was involved in the road lobby and was accused of closing the railways to aid his motorway building business.

The nearest we had was the UTA up north who closed the Portadown - Derry railway on the promise of a replacement Motorway that has only got as far as Dungannon in 60 years since closure, incidentally they are talking about reopening it in the All Ireland rail plan. The closure of the Harcourt line in 1961 was one of Tod Andrews biggest errors.

https://www.openrailwaymap.org/ has a little more detail of the preferred route before the Dunshaughin revision, except serving slightly west to avoid the Station house (hotel) at the old junction in Kilmessan, it more or less the the original 1863 route with Navan North spur on the old Kingscourt branch.
